For all the slashing and burning of recent years, the ecosystem still stores about 120 billion tons of carbon in its trunks, branches, vines and soil — the equivalent of about ten years of human emissions. It turns out that deforestation numbers actually understate the problem of the Amazon, because a fifth of the standing forest has been "degraded" by logging, burning and fragmentation. The Amazon has been called "the lungs of the earth" because of the amount of carbon dioxide it absorbs — according to most estimates, around half a billion tons per year.

When Nobre started trying to forecast the impact of deforestation back in 1988, he had to do it at the University of Maryland, because his home country lacked the computing power for serious climate modeling.
